In Crimea, SOF warriors struck the “eyes” of a Russian S-400 “Triumf” air defense system
On the night of September 30, units of the Special Operations Forces struck the radar station of a Russian S-400 “Triumf” surface-to-air missile system in the temporarily occupied territories of the Autonomous Republic of Crimea.
This was reported by the Special Operations Forces of the Armed Forces of Ukraine.
“It is symbolic that the enemy’s expensive air defense system, designed in particular to counter UAVs, was neutralized by SOF strike drones. The radar station is the ‘eyes’ of the S-400 ‘Triumf’ system. Without the surveillance and targeting element, the entire system loses its combat effectiveness”, – the statement reads.
It was noted that SOF units continue to inflict significant damage on the enemy, accelerating its inability to conduct further hostilities.
